Understanding Driving Side: A Global Perspective

The answer to "is left side driver or passenger" isn't straightforward; it depends entirely on the country you're in. This is because countries adhere to either "right-hand traffic" (RHT) or "left-hand traffic" (LHT) systems.

  • Right-Hand Traffic (RHT): In RHT countries, vehicles drive on the right side of the road. Consequently, the driver sits on the left side of the car, and the passenger sits on the right. This is the dominant system worldwide.

  • Left-Hand Traffic (LHT): In LHT countries, vehicles drive on the left side of the road. Naturally, the driver sits on the right side of the car, and the passenger sits on the left.

Why the Difference? A Historical Overview

The divergence between RHT and LHT has historical roots, primarily related to modes of transportation prior to automobiles.

Origins of Left-Hand Traffic

Some historians theorize that LHT stemmed from medieval equestrian practices. Most people are right-handed, and when encountering a stranger on a road, it was safer to keep your right (sword) arm free for defense. Therefore, riders would pass on the left, keeping their right side towards the center of the road.

Origins of Right-Hand Traffic

RHT is often associated with the French Revolution. Maximilien Robespierre advocated for RHT to break from aristocratic tradition, and Napoleon later codified it in many of the territories he conquered. The system was also naturally suited to large teams of horses pulling wagons; the driver (often on the rearmost left horse) needed to be on the left to easily oversee the other horses.

Prevalence of Each System

While the exact numbers fluctuate, RHT is significantly more prevalent than LHT.

Key RHT Countries

  • United States
  • Most of Europe (excluding the UK, Ireland, Malta, and Cyprus)
  • China
  • Brazil
  • Canada

Key LHT Countries

  • United Kingdom
  • Australia
  • Japan
  • India
  • South Africa

Impact on Vehicle Design

The driving system directly influences vehicle design, particularly the placement of controls and mirrors.

Steering Wheel and Pedal Placement

  • RHT Vehicles: Steering wheel and pedals are positioned for the driver on the left.
  • LHT Vehicles: Steering wheel and pedals are positioned for the driver on the right.

Mirror and Headlight Alignment

Headlights are often designed to illuminate the side of the road the driver needs to see most clearly. Mirrors are positioned to optimize visibility based on the driver's seating arrangement.
